Tara Westover was born on September 27, 1986, in a remote mountainous area of Idaho. She is 34 years old right now. She is the seventh child of Mormon survivalist parents who practiced their religion blindly. LaRee, her mother, was a midwife as well as a herbal healer. Summary. Tara begins her first year at Brigham Young University, a Mormon college in Provo, Utah. Tara has a very difficult time adjusting to her new life, both at home and in the classroom. When she meets her roommates, Tara is shocked when she realizes that they do not abide by religious doctrine as strictly as she does.

Educated Study Guide. Educated is a memoir written by Tara Westover. The story recounts Tara's unusual upbringing as the daughter of extremist Mormon survivalists. Westover's father, referred to as "Gene" in the memoir, does not allow his seven children to go to school or to receive medical treatment. Vanessa. One of Tara ’s classmates at BYU. Though they bond over being the only freshmen in an advanced history class, but their friendship is halted when Vanessa is outraged over Tara’s ignorance about the Holocaust—an event whose existence Tara never even knew about before hearing it discussed in class. Tara Westover [2] is an American memoirist, essayist and historian. Her memoir Educated (2018) debuted at No. 1 on The New York Times bestseller list. She was chosen by Time magazine as one of the 100 most influential people of 2019.
